API Gateway REST APIからHTTP APIを経由してLambdaを実行する – 【AWS】 REST APIからHTTP APIを経由してLambdaを実行する - 【AWS】REST APIのリソースポリシーを使用しつつ、HTTP APIのJWT検証をしたかったので、REST APIからHTTP API経由でLambdaを実行で... 2023.08.27 API Gateway
API Gateway API Gateway(HTTP API)でJWTの検証を行う API Gateway(HTTP API)でJWTの検証を行うHTTP APIのJWTオーソライザーを利用してJWTの検証を行います。HTTP APIHTTP APIを作成します。JWTオーソライザー作成したAPI(POST)に対してJWT... 2023.08.26 API Gateway
API Gateway API Gateway + Lambda(Java17)で複数REST APIを作成する – 【aws-serverless-java-container】 API Gateway + Lambda(Java17)で複数REST APIを作成する - 【aws-serverless-java-container】aws-serverless-java-containerを使用して、1つのLamb... 2023.08.24 API GatewayLambda(Java)
API Gateway API GatewayからLambda(PHP)を呼び出す API GatewayからLambda(PHP)を呼び出す前提 項目 バージョン OS Ubuntu 20.04.4 LTS PHP PHP 7.4.3-4ubuntu2.17 (cli) (built: Jan 10 2023 15:37... 2023.02.06 API GatewayLambda(PHP)
API Gateway API Gatewayのリソースポリシーで特定IPからのアクセス制限を行う API Gatewayのリソースポリシーで特定IPからのアクセス制限を行うAPI GatewayのリソースポリシーでIP制限をしてみます。リソースポリシー{ "Version": "2012-10-17", "Statement": [ {... 2022.09.08 API Gateway
API Gateway API Gateway(REST API)+Lambda(node.js v16)でファイル送信したデータを受け取る方法 API Gateway(REST API)+Lambda(node.js v16)でファイル送信したデータを受け取る方法 2022.08.20 API GatewayLambda(node.js)
API Gateway API Gateway(REST API)でmultiValueQueryStringParametersを使用してクエリ文字列パラメータで配列を渡す API Gateway(REST API)でmultiValueQueryStringParametersを使用してクエリ文字列パラメータで配列を渡すAPI Gateway+Lambda(node.js)でクエリ文字列パラメータで配列を渡す... 2022.08.20 API Gateway
API Gateway 認可にAWS IAMを設定してcurlする – 【API Gateway】 認可にAWS IAMを設定してcurlする - 【API Gateway】REST APIとHTTP APIどちらでも対応しているAWS IAM認可処理を実装してみます。REST APIREST APIで実装してみます。GETメソッドに対し... 2022.02.07 API Gateway
API Gateway CloudFront + API Gateway CloudFront + API GatewayAPI Gatewayの前にCDNであるCloudFrontを配置します。「ディストリビューションを作成」をクリックします。API Gatewayはhttpsのみサポートしているので「http... 2021.03.06 API GatewayCloudFront
API Gateway API Gatewayデプロイ時にバックエンドがLambdaの時はhttpMethodはPOSTにする API Gatewayデプロイ時にバックエンドがLambdaの時はhttpMethodはPOSTにするSwaggerファイルを使ってAPI Gatewayデプロイするときに、x-amazon-apigateway-integrationがあ... 2020.07.09 API GatewayAWS
API Gateway API GatewayをCloudFormationでデプロイする際にTagsを設定する方法 API GatewayをCloudFormationでデプロイする際にTagsを設定する方法 2020.07.06 API GatewayAWSCloudFormation
API Gateway API Gatewayのcors有効化をOpen APIで実装する API Gatewayのcors有効化をOpen APIで実装するLambdaプロキシ統合Open APIのymlファイルにcors設定を追加します。OPTIONSメソッドを追加します。 options: responses: "200":... 2020.03.08 API Gateway
API Gateway DockerとSwaggerHubが使えない環境で他チームのAPIをモックする方法 DockerとSwaggerHubが使えない環境で他チームのAPIをモックする方法API開発中に他チームのAPIをモックしてテストしていかないといけなくなりました。(APIからAPIを呼ぶケース)Docker使えないし、SwaggerHub... 2020.03.02 API GatewayAWS
API Gateway API Gateway(Lambdaプロキシの統合) + Lambdaでcorsを有効にする API Gateway(Lambdaプロキシの統合) + Lambdaでcorsを有効にするクロスオリジンリクエストの場合シンプルリクエストの場合Lambdaのheadersに"Access-Control-Allow-Origin":'*... 2020.02.24 API Gateway
API Gateway API GatewayのAWS_IAMでクエリパラメータにX-Amz-Expiresを追加してURLの認可期限を延ばしたい API GatewayのAWS_IAMでクエリパラメータにX-Amz-Expiresを追加してURLの認可期限を延ばしたいAPI Gatewayの認可でAWS_IAMを指定すると、ヘッダ情報にAuthentication情報を付加する必要が... 2020.02.21 API Gateway
API Gateway シェルでAPI GatewayのOpenAPI(Yaml or JSON)からAWSのベンダープレフィックスを削除する方法 シェルでAPI GatewayのOpenAPI(Yaml or JSON)からAWSのベンダープレフィックスを削除する方法x-amazonで始まるプロパティを一括削除したい時に、node.jsのjs-yamlを使ってプログラム作成するかとか... 2020.02.14 API Gatewaybash
API Gateway superagentモジュールでAPI Gatewayのテストをする superagentモジュールでAPI GatewayのテストをするAPI Gatewayのテストをする時にPOSTMANやVSCodeのRest Clientプラグインなどがありますが、mochaからsuperagentモジュールを使って... 2020.02.04 API Gatewaynode.jsnode.jsのテストライブラリsuperagent
API Gateway API GatewayからSwagger +API Gateway 拡張の形式でエクスポートしたファイルからRedoc-CLIで静的ドキュメントを作成する方法 API GatewayからSwagger +API Gateway 拡張の形式でエクスポートしたファイルからRedoc-CLIで静的ドキュメントを作成する方法 2019.12.20 API GatewayAWSRedocSwagger
API Gateway API GatewayをエクスポートしてSwagger-UIを使う方法 API GatewayをエクスポートしてSwagger-UIを使う方法API GatewayをデプロイしたらステージエディターでOpenAPI3.0+API Gateway拡張の形式でyaml or JSONファイルをエクスポートすることが... 2019.12.19 API GatewayAWSSwagger
API Gateway API Gateway+LambdaでヘッダにSet-Cookieを複数設定する方法 API Gateway+LambdaでヘッダにSet-Cookieを複数設定する方法CloudFrontの署名付きCookieを使用しようとしたのですが、3つSet-Cookieを設定する必要があります。ところが、API GatewayはS... 2019.12.18 API GatewayAWSLambda(node.js)
API Gateway API GatewayからVPCリンクを使用してNLBに接続する API GatewayからVPCリンクを使用してNLBに接続する 2019.12.16 API GatewayAWSNLB
API Gateway AWS API GatewayからLambdaを通さずにS3へ連携する方法 AWS API GatewayからLambdaを通さずにS3へ連携する方法 2019.12.14 API GatewayAWSS3
API Gateway AWS LambdaのエイリアスとAPI Gatewayを関連付ける方法 AWS LambdaのエイリアスとAPI Gatewayを関連付ける方法 2019.12.13 API GatewayAWSLambda
API Gateway AWS API Gatewayのカスタムドメインを実装する方法 AWS API Gatewayのカスタムドメインを実装する方法API Gatewayのカスタムドメインを実装できるか実験しました。「API Gateway でリージョン別の REST API または WebSocket API 用カスタムド... 2019.12.06 API GatewayAWS
API Gateway AWS Lambdaをバージョン管理してステージごとに実行するLambdaのバージョンを分ける方法 AWS Lambdaをバージョン管理してステージごとに実行するLambdaのバージョンを分ける方法Lambdaはバージョン管理しておくことができます。バージョン管理すると$LATESTが最新バージョンのLambdaとなり、このバージョンのみ... 2019.11.24 API GatewayAWSLambda
API Gateway Amazon API GatewayからREST API経由でLambdaを実行する(デプロイしてAPI公開する) Amazon API GatewayからREST API経由でLambdaを実行する(デプロイしてAPI公開する)「Amazon API Gatewayの使い方とクエリ文字列パラメータの渡し方」で2017年末あたりにAPI Gatewayか... 2019.11.24 API GatewayAWS
API Gateway AWS Cognitoで認証した後、認可したAPI GatewayにユーザIDを渡す AWS Cognitoで認証した後、認可したAPI GatewayにユーザIDを渡すCognitoで認証した後に認可しているAPI GatewayにユーザIDを渡したい場合があるかも知れません。でもないかもしれません。とりあえず渡す方法は一... 2018.05.03 API GatewayAWSCognitoLambda
API Gateway AWSのCloudFrontでS3,EC2,API GatewayをPath Patternで分けて一つの独自ドメイン(HTTPS)に纏める AWSのCloudFrontでS3,EC2,API GatewayをPath Patternで分けて一つの独自ドメイン(HTTPS)に纏めるCloudFrontのマルチオリジンを使用してPath Patternを分けることによって一つのドメ... 2018.04.14 API GatewayAWSCloudFrontEC2ELBRoute 53S3
ACM AWS Cognitoで認証画面を作成してサインイン後にAPI GatewayをCognitoで認可する AWS Cognitoで認証画面を作成してサインイン後にAPI GatewayをCognitoで認可するAWS Cognitoでは認証画面は提供していません。(でも提供していたらどなたか教えてください)認証画面を自作します。ちょっと凝ったこ... 2018.04.09 ACMAPI GatewayAWSCloudFrontCognitoRoute 53S3
API Gateway API GatewayでプライベートAPIを作成する方法 API GatewayでプライベートAPIを作成する方法プライベートAPIを作成して、自分のアカウントのEC2からしかアクセスできないプライベートAPIを作成します。エンドポイントの作成まずVPCでエンドポイントを作成します。セキュリティグ... 2018.03.21 API GatewayAWS
API Gateway API Gatewayのオーソライザーの機能を確認してみる API Gatewayのオーソライザーの機能を確認してみるAPI Gatewayのオーソライザー機能を利用すると、認可をすることができるようになります。「トークン」タイプと「リクエスト」タイプがあるようです。トークンタイプトークンタイプの設... 2018.03.20 API GatewayAWS
API Gateway Amazon API Gatewayの使い方とクエリ文字列パラメータの渡し方 Amazon API Gatewayの使い方とクエリ文字列パラメータの渡し方Amazon API Gatewayの使い方についてです。 「新しいAPIの作成」画面でAPI名を入力し、「APIの作成」をクリックします。リソースの作成次にリソー... 2017.10.17 API GatewayAWS